Transaction 3cb3d2418bb832e4bb464f391a02f1adaed24ddecf43bb2abbf3f958395e4e2e
4 Input
1 Outputs
- 3cb3d2418bb832e4bb464f391a02f1adaed24ddecf43bb2abbf3f958395e4e2e:0
value 121609201
address 1JBsvtFjdKzwLtoUkJEtf8NzKzxQmsinwQ